WebJahoda mentions Heinz Hartmann who sees evolution as leading toward more and more autonomy, whereby there is the “growing independence from the outside world, insofar as a process of inner regulation replaces the reactions and actions due to fear of the social environment (social anxiety)” (Jahoda, p. 46). Web28 feb. 2024 · Jahoda suggested six criteria necessary for ideal mental health. An absence of any of these characteristics indicates individuals as being abnormal, in other words displaying deviation from ideal mental health. Resistance to stress: Having effective coping strategies and being able to cope with everyday anxiety-provoking situations.
